Roof Cleaning
- Roof cleaning extends the life of your roof by removing moss, algae, and debris that cause premature deterioration.
- A clean roof improves curb appeal, giving your property a refreshed and well-maintained appearance.
- Regular cleaning prevents stains, streaks, and discoloration that can damage shingles and lower property value.
- Removing organic buildup reduces the risk of leaks and water intrusion that can compromise the home’s structure.
- Professional roof cleaning enhances energy efficiency by keeping roofing materials free of heat-trapping growth and debris.
- Maintaining a clean roof helps preserve warranties that require regular maintenance for coverage.
- Professional services ensure safe cleaning practices that protect both the roof and the homeowner from accidents.
FAQ for Roof Cleaning
- Why is roof cleaning important?
It removes damaging debris and growths, extending the lifespan of roofing materials. - How often should a roof be cleaned?
Most roofs benefit from professional cleaning every 1 to 3 years, depending on location and climate. - What issues can arise if a roof is not cleaned?
Without cleaning, moss, algae, and dirt can cause staining, leaks, and material breakdown. - Is professional roof cleaning safe for shingles?
Yes, when done by experts using proper equipment and methods designed for roof materials. - Does roof cleaning improve a home’s appearance?
Absolutely, a clean roof instantly boosts curb appeal and enhances overall property value.
